TELKOM South Africa's Worst ISP
In 2020 at the beginning of Lock Down I took out a LTE deal with telkom for R999 a month for uncapped LTE.
Fast forward to 2022 March my contract was completed.
I then just continued using the service up until June/July when I moved to a area where there was frogfoot fibre.
I then took out fibre package which included a xbox series S with a 3 month subscription to gamepass (there was no gamepass).
Never could I have imagined that this was just the beginning of the horror that would start to unfold.
I had been advised by the Sales team that as soon as the fibre was installed that my LTE subscription would be canceled in the new month and I would not be left with two payments at the end of the month.
2 months pass and my fibre was still not working logged countless tickets with reference numbers that were closed without checking with me if my internet was working.
Eventually it started to work yet I was still being debited for fibre and LTE.
In October 2022 I was debited R1898.00 in the middle of the month and then tried to debit me the same amount at the end of October for the same amount which I canceled.
They the suspended my LTE account due to collections( remember I said it was a month to month contract and only pay for the month I will use)
I have been cut off from both Fibre and LTE due to collections, to make things worse telkom is refusing to cancel my LTE and wants me to pay the balance and the Fibre.
I have complained but this ISP is not helping me.
30mbps that lags and I cannot even stream on two devices without it buffering.
Is there anyone that can help me cancel all of this as technically speaking they owe me R898 for the payments made to the LTE . I have recordings of the telkom team telling me that with supporting documents.
